A Late Federal Grained And Red-Painted Pine Two Drawer Mule Chest
New England, Circa 1820

with lift-lid top, over two faux drawer fronts, above two long drawers, shaped apron, upper drawer inscribed to side, "Gift of Mr. & Mrs. W.C. Riker."

Height 37 1/2 x width 40 x depth 18 3/4 inches.
